Brenda's licking the end of her tail into a spike
Hello all, Our Brenda has started a habit she licks the end of her
tail until it looks like spike. She walks around with her tail straight in the air. I have searched to see if there is any injury, but No, nothing... She is not licking the fur off just fashioning it into a spike. Brenda is one of four cats she is the youngest being two years old. Has anyone heard od seen this before. |

Brenda's licking the end of her tail into a spike
You could try putting some Bitter Apple on the end of the tail a couple
times day to break her of the habit. You can find it at the local pet store or feed supply place. It's a deterant for this type of stuff and taste absolutely awful but won't hurt the cat. I have used it on my previous lab who was a constant cleaner when she got any type of cut or scratch and it wouldn't heal because she kept licking it. It's also great to spray on cords & stuff you don't want dogs or cats chewing on. Celeste wrote in message oups.com...
